As someone who rotated at Denver on an EM Sub I and interviewed for their program, I never got the impression that residents were overworked and miserable. On the contrary most of them were really happy with their choice and enjoying their time.

The residents were transparent that to be successful at the residency you need to be ready to work hard and that you are pushed to excellence. But it comes with the reward of being incredibly trained in a range of settings with excellent efficiency and throughput.

Never got malignant vibes, just leaning more towards professional and hard working.

I think it’s realistic for any and all residents at 3 and 4 year programs to experience burn out at one point or another. Saw it in 3 year program sub is and 4 year programs. It’s bound to happen in the messed up US healthcare system. Denver is not immune to that.

automatic zooming from hovering over images? by rkway25 in Anki

[–]WikKnows 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Go to a card in the AnKing deck in the browser. Click "Cards..."
On the left side of the pop up in the middle box labeled "Styling (shared between cards) "section there should be the following text about halfway down to the bottom.

/*Image hover zoom*/
#firstaid img:hover { transform:scale(1.5); }
#sketchy img:hover { transform:scale(1.5); }
#physeo img:hover { transform:scale(1.5); }
#additional img:hover { transform:scale(1.5); }
.mobile #firstaid img:hover { transform:scale(1.0); }
.mobile #sketchy img:hover { transform:scale(1.0); }
.mobile #physeo img:hover { transform:scale(1.0); }
.mobile #additional img:hover { transform:scale(1.0); }

Try fiddling with the numbers in scale(1.5).

I'm no coder but I think if you take it to (1.0) or delete that portion it could help. I would leave all the .mobile portions alone though.
